What is Cable Grip and what is its use?
Cable grabber is a mechanical device designed to grab, hold and pull power, telecommunication or fiber optic cables without damaging the conductor or its insulation. This tool is sometimes known as Pulling Grip or Wire Rope Grip.

Working mechanism and main components:
* Body (Shell): usually made of galvanized steel or light and resistant alloys.
* Gripping Jaws/Teeth: located inside the body. These jaws, which are mostly made of hardened steel, grip the cable tightly by applying pressure to the outer sheath of the cable (not the inner conductor). Their design is such that the more the tension increases, the tighter the hooks close.
* Pulling Eye: A ring or eye at the end of the box to which the steel rope, chain or winch hook is connected.
* Neoprene Sleeve: In some models, a rubber sleeve is stretched over the cable and part of the boxel to protect the cable sleeve from scratches and additional wear.
The advantages of using the towing cable holder:
* Prevents damage to the cable: the tension force is evenly distributed on the cable circumference and prevents tearing, excessive stretching or damage to the internal conductors.
* Ability to bear heavy loads: designed for cables with a very high diameter and weight (even several tons).
* Speed and safety of operation: It is quick to install and eliminates the need for knotting or complicated connections, which increases the safety of the workshop.
* Reusability: Most boxes (especially mechanical models) can be easily opened and reused when finished.

Important points in choosing and using:
*Diameter Match: Must match the outer diameter of the cable exactly.
* Maximum allowable load (SWL): must be greater than the maximum tensile force expected in operation.
* Cable sheath material: some boxes are more suitable for cables with PVC sheath and some for polyethylene or metal sheaths.
* Pre-use inspection: Always make sure the jaws, body and locking mechanism are intact.
